A North Dakota LLC name search should happen before paying the $135 registration fee. North Dakota’s FirstStop business search helps identify existing registrations, but it does not guarantee trademark or domain rights.

How to search
- Search North Dakota business records for the exact proposed name.
- Search close spellings, punctuation, singular, and plural forms.
- Check names that sound similar, not only exact matches.
- Confirm the name includes “limited liability company,” “LLC,” or “L.L.C.”
- Check restricted words such as banking or trust terms.
- Search federal trademarks before using the name publicly.
- Check the domain and social handles separately.
Consent and trade names
If a proposed name is already reserved or registered, North Dakota may allow a consent-to-use filing with the required fee. A trade name is a separate registration and does not replace the LLC’s legal name.
The state’s trade-name protection applies in North Dakota only. It does not replace a federal trademark search.
Name FAQ
Does a business search reserve the name?
No. Search and any reservation or consent filing are separate steps.
Does a trade name create the LLC?
No. The LLC still needs its own registration.
Should I search trademarks?
Yes, especially if the name will appear on products, advertising, or a website.
